How tf do surf shops stay open so long? by memelord152 in surfing

[–]TheCrabPot 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Hello, I’ve worked wholesale within the industry for 20yrs selling to surf skate snow. Imo surf outlasts because shapers manufacture something thats locally respected and specific to the area (if they’re any good). Also skateboarding has dire peaks and troughs as an industry but surfing has steadily grown
